Gold price sets new record above $3,050 following Fed verdict

Gold hit another all-time high on Wednesday afternoon, surpassing the $3,050-an-ounce level, after US policymakers projected slower growth and higher inflation.By 5 p.m. in New York, spot prices traded 0.4% higher at $3,045.66 an ounce, having earlier reached a high of $3,051.42. US gold futures went up 0.6% to $3,056.20 an ounce.Gold’s new record follows a press conference by US Federal Reserve chair Jerome Powell on Wednesday, in which he acknowledged the “high degree of uncertainty” from President Donald Trump’s significant policy changes.However, Powell also stressed that the US central bank is not in a hurry to adjust borrowing costs, and policymakers will wait on “greater clarity” before acting.Despite rising inflation, the Federal Open Market Committee has voted to keep the benchmark federal funds rate in a range of 4.25%-4.5%.
